microsoft certified systems engineer (mcse)

Microsoft's top-level certification - professionals certified as MCSE have the expertise to analyse business requirements to design & implement an infrastructure solution based on the Windows platform & Microsoft Server software.

microsoft certified professional + internet (mcp+i)

Professionals certified as MCP+I have the skills to successfully implement a Microsoft product or technology as part of a business solution within an organisation, with specific expertise in Internet services.

microsoft certified professional (mcp)

Professionals certified as MCP have the skills to successfully implement a Microsoft product or technology as part of a business solution in an organisation

cisco certified network associate (ccna)

Professionals certified as CCNA have the expertise to install & maintain local & wide area networks (LANs, WANs) & dial-up services in networks of 100 nodes or less - the typical Small/Medium Enterprise environment (SME).

cisco certified design associate (ccda)

Professionals certified as CCDA have the expertise to design routed & switched network infrastructures involving LAN, WAN, & dial access services for businesses and organizations.

draytek enterprise partner (dep)

A DrayTek Enterprise Partner is able to provide:

Experienced Pre-Sales Technical staff able to discuss your requirements - experienced not only in firewalls, routers, VoIP and VPN applications but also specifically the Vigor3300V - they will have seen and used the product themselves.

Experienced after-sales technical support. Engineers will be able to assist you, by telephone (or by email if you prefer) in setting up and using your product as required. This is available by telephone during normal office hours and the engineer will have specific experience of the Vigor3300V. Support will be by regular phone numbers, not premium rate or mobile numbers.

Support engineers who have direct access to DrayTek UK's second line support engineers for any complex support issues.

DrayTek's 3-Year UK Warranty. The UK service centre will provide prompt service in the unlikely event of your product needing service (subject to registration and normal warranty terms).

Your supplier will be selling these products on an ongoing basis, not a 'one-off' which means they are familiar with the products capabilies and flexibility, so can use it to best advantage. VigorCare - Your new Vigor3300V includes VigorCare cover for 90 days from purchase (subject to registration with DrayTek UK); VigorCare is currently available in the UK only, and can be renewed subject to normal VigorCare terms.

Your DrayTek Enterprise Partner will supply only UK stock with full UK warranty and all appropriate adaptors/documentation.

Your supplier may offer value added services at extra cost, such as physical installation, configuration of VPN/filter sets (configuring 200 remote users can take time!) or other on-site or remote services.
